Problem Cause Solution
Parts of images are not
copied.
The correct paper size is not
selected.
Select the proper paper size.
Images appear only partially. The paper is damp. Use paper that has been stored in the
recommended temperature and
humidity condition. For details about the
proper way to store it, see “Paper
Storage”, About This Machine.
Image density is uneven. The original has areas of solid
color, or [Positive/Negative]
is selected when copying
multiple sheets.
When using Repeat Copy with originals
that have areas of solid color, set the
number of originals as follows: A0 - A2
(E - C): 1 sheet, A3 (B) or smaller: 3
sheets. For details about sizes of
originals, see “Measure Chart”, Copy/
Document Server Reference.
Image density is uneven. Halftone originals can cause
this problem.
Try using “Text / Photo”.
Images are blurred when
using translucent paper.
Translucent paper is being
used when copying multiple
sheets.
Select a proper paper thickness for the
copy paper. See “Tray Paper Settings”,
General Settings Guide.
Extreme wrinkling occurs
when using translucent
paper.
An improper paper thickness
is selected.
Select a proper paper thickness for the
copy paper. See “Tray Paper Settings”,
General Settings Guide.
Strong wrinkles appear when
using translucent paper.
The paper type has recently
been changed from plain
paper to translucent paper.
Wait about one minute.
Streaks, scratches, or
wrinkles appear in areas of
solid black.
Copy paper has been
changed from plain to
translucent paper, or from
translucent to plain paper.
After switching from plain to translucent
paper, wait one minute. After switching
from translucent to plain paper, wait two
minutes before making copies.
Black lines appear. The exposure glass or
scanning glass is dirty.
Clean them. See p.99 "Maintaining
Your Machine".
White lines appear. The exposure glass or
scanning glass is dirty.
Clean them. See p.99 "Maintaining
Your Machine".
